HERO

Landslide

Season 1, Episode 22

"Poised to become a member of Congress and maybe more, Nathan considers the cost to those he loves, along with his mother's advice and Linderman’s prophecy. As he prepares to face Sylar to the death, Hiro learns of his lineage from his father. While various "heroes" fatefully arrive in New York City, Peter and Ted attempt to leave the city before the foretold explosion. H.R.G. and Matt learn the surprising truth behind the tracking system used on people with special abilities."-NBC

And for those of you that don't know, Heroes: Origins will start after season one ends. It will be a series of one shot episodes that center on a new hero each week until the new season of the mother program Heroes starts (right now only 6 are ordered, but if it's successful, they'll continue to have no breaks or reruns of Heroes). At the end the viewers can vote for a new character to be added to the show, based on how well we like the story or character.
